Understanding Your Civic’s Cooling System: Why a Healthy Thermostat Matters

Your 2004 Honda Civic’s engine generates a tremendous amount of heat. Without an efficient cooling system, that heat would quickly destroy vital components. At the heart of this system is the thermostat, a deceptively simple device that plays a critical role.

Think of the thermostat as the traffic cop for your engine’s coolant. When the engine is cold, it stays closed, allowing the engine to warm up quickly to its optimal operating temperature. Once that temperature is reached, the thermostat opens, letting coolant flow through the radiator to dissipate heat.

A properly functioning thermostat ensures your engine maintains a consistent temperature. This leads to better fuel economy, reduced emissions, and less wear and tear on internal engine parts. The benefits of 2004 Honda Civic thermostat replacement are clear: improved engine health, consistent cabin heating, and peace of mind on the road.

The Role of the Thermostat in Engine Performance

  • Rapid Warm-Up: A closed thermostat helps the engine reach its ideal operating temperature faster, improving efficiency.
  • Temperature Regulation: It continuously adjusts the flow of coolant to keep the engine within its optimal temperature range.
  • Fuel Efficiency: An engine running at the correct temperature burns fuel more efficiently.
  • Reduced Wear: Consistent temperatures minimize thermal stress on engine components.

Symptoms of a Failing Thermostat: When to Consider a 2004 Honda Civic Thermostat Replacement

Knowing when your thermostat is on its way out is key to preventing bigger issues. Your Civic will often give you clear warning signs. Don’t ignore these signals; they’re your car’s way of telling you it needs attention.

One of the most common indicators is an erratic temperature gauge. It might climb rapidly, then drop, or stay consistently high or low. These fluctuations suggest the thermostat isn’t opening or closing correctly.

Here are the key symptoms that point towards needing a 2004 Honda Civic thermostat replacement:

  • Engine Overheating: This is the most serious symptom. If your temperature gauge is constantly in the red or steam is coming from under the hood, your thermostat might be stuck closed. Pull over immediately!
  • Engine Running Cold (Underheating): If your engine takes a very long time to warm up, or the temperature gauge never reaches the normal operating range, the thermostat might be stuck open. This reduces fuel efficiency and increases engine wear.
  • Erratic Temperature Gauge Readings: The needle might fluctuate wildly, indicating the thermostat is partially sticking or opening inconsistently.
  • Poor Heater Performance: If your engine isn’t reaching its proper temperature, the coolant won’t be hot enough to provide adequate heat to the cabin.
  • Coolant Leaks (less common but possible): Sometimes, a faulty thermostat housing gasket can lead to coolant leaks around the thermostat area.

Catching these symptoms early can save you from costly repairs down the line. If you notice any of these, it’s time to prepare for a replacement.

Gathering Your Gear: Tools and Parts for Your 2004 Honda Civic Thermostat Replacement

Before you dive in, having all your tools and parts ready makes the job smoother and faster. This isn’t a complex job, but having the right equipment is essential for safety and efficiency. We’ll outline what you need for a successful how to 2004 Honda Civic thermostat replacement experience.

Investing in quality parts, especially the thermostat itself, is a smart move. OEM (Original Equipment Manufacturer) parts are always a safe bet, but reputable aftermarket brands like Gates, Stant, or Motorad also offer excellent choices. Avoid cheap, no-name brands that might fail prematurely.

Essential Tools and Supplies

  • New Thermostat: Ensure it’s the correct temperature rating for your 2004 Honda Civic (usually 170°F or 180°F, check your owner’s manual or a parts catalog).
  • New Thermostat Gasket or O-ring: Often comes with the new thermostat, but double-check.
  • New Coolant: You’ll lose some during the process. Use the correct type for your Honda Civic (typically a blue or green long-life coolant, check your owner’s manual).
  • Drain Pan: To catch old coolant. A 5-gallon bucket works well.
  • Socket Wrench Set: You’ll likely need 10mm and 12mm sockets.
  • Pliers: For hose clamps. Hose clamp pliers are ideal, but regular slip-joint pliers can work.
  • Flathead Screwdriver: For prying, if needed.
  • Rags or Shop Towels: For spills and cleanup.
  • Wire Brush or Scraper: To clean the thermostat housing mating surface.
  • Safety Glasses and Gloves: Always protect your eyes and hands when working with automotive fluids.
  • Funnel: For refilling coolant.
  • Torque Wrench (Recommended): To ensure bolts are tightened to factory specifications, preventing leaks.

The Step-by-Step 2004 Honda Civic Thermostat Replacement Guide

Now for the main event! This section provides a detailed, actionable 2004 Honda Civic thermostat replacement guide. Remember, safety first! Work on a cold engine, wear your protective gear, and take your time. This guide assumes a basic level of DIY comfort.

The thermostat on a 2004 Honda Civic is typically located on the driver’s side of the engine, near the lower radiator hose connection to the engine block. It’s usually housed in a two-piece plastic or aluminum housing.

  1. Safety First and Prepare the Vehicle:
    • Ensure the engine is completely cool. Working on a hot engine can cause severe burns from hot coolant and steam.
    • Park your Civic on a level surface.
    • Open the hood and locate the radiator cap. Do NOT open it if the engine is warm.
    • Place your drain pan beneath the radiator drain plug or the lower radiator hose connection.
  2. Drain the Coolant:
    • Once the engine is cold, open the radiator drain petcock (usually a white or yellow plastic wing nut on the bottom of the radiator, driver’s side).
    • Allow the coolant to drain completely into your pan. This might take 10-15 minutes.
    • You can also remove the radiator cap (when cold!) to speed up the draining process.
    • Close the drain petcock once the flow stops.
  3. Locate and Access the Thermostat Housing:
    • The thermostat housing is typically where the lower radiator hose connects to the engine block or intake manifold.
    • Use your pliers to loosen the clamp on the lower radiator hose where it connects to the thermostat housing. Slide the clamp back onto the hose.
    • Carefully twist and pull the lower radiator hose off the housing. Be prepared for a small amount of residual coolant to spill out.
  4. Remove the Old Thermostat:
    • The thermostat housing is usually held on by two 10mm or 12mm bolts. Use your socket wrench to remove these bolts.
    • Gently pry the thermostat housing cover off. The thermostat itself should be visible inside, often spring-loaded.
    • Note the orientation of the old thermostat before removing it. It usually has a jiggle valve or a small pin that needs to face up or towards a specific direction.
    • Remove the old thermostat and its gasket/O-ring.
  5. Clean the Mating Surfaces:
    • This is a critical step for preventing leaks! Use a wire brush or scraper to thoroughly clean both mating surfaces: the engine block/manifold surface and the thermostat housing cover.
    • Ensure there are no old gasket remnants, corrosion, or debris. A clean surface is paramount for a good seal.
  6. Install the New Thermostat:
    • Place the new gasket or O-ring onto the new thermostat, or directly onto the housing, as per the design.
    • Insert the new thermostat into the housing, ensuring it’s oriented correctly (jiggle valve facing up or as noted during removal).
    • Reattach the thermostat housing cover, making sure the gasket/O-ring is properly seated.
    • Hand-tighten the two bolts first, then use your socket wrench to tighten them evenly. If you have a torque wrench, refer to your service manual for the correct torque specification (typically around 7-10 ft-lbs). Do not overtighten, as you can strip threads or crack the housing.
  7. Reconnect the Lower Radiator Hose:
    • Slide the lower radiator hose back onto the thermostat housing connection.
    • Reposition the hose clamp over the connection point and secure it tightly with your pliers. Give it a gentle tug to ensure it’s firm.
  8. Refill the Cooling System:
    • Using a funnel, slowly pour new, appropriate coolant into the radiator until it’s full.
    • Leave the radiator cap off for now.
  9. Bleed the Air from the System:
    • This is perhaps the most important step for a successful 2004 Honda Civic thermostat replacement. Air pockets in the cooling system can cause localized overheating and prevent the thermostat from functioning correctly.
    • Start the engine with the radiator cap off. Turn your car’s heater to its highest setting (fan doesn’t need to be on high, just the temperature).
    • As the engine warms up, the coolant level in the radiator will likely drop as air bubbles escape. Keep topping off the coolant as needed.
    • Squeeze the upper and lower radiator hoses repeatedly to help dislodge air bubbles.
    • Watch for the thermostat to open (you’ll see a surge of coolant flow in the radiator neck). This indicates the thermostat is working.
    • Continue this process for 15-20 minutes, or until no more bubbles appear and the coolant level stabilizes. The engine temperature gauge should be at its normal operating level.
    • Once stable, put the radiator cap back on securely.
  10. Final Check:
    • Take your Civic for a short test drive, keeping an eye on the temperature gauge.
    • After the drive and once the engine has cooled down, recheck the coolant level in the radiator and the overflow reservoir. Top off if necessary.
    • Inspect the thermostat housing area for any signs of leaks.

Post-Replacement Best Practices: Bleeding, Testing, and Care

Completing the physical replacement is a huge step, but the job isn’t truly done until you’ve ensured everything is running perfectly. Adopting these 2004 Honda Civic thermostat replacement best practices will safeguard your work and your engine.

Proper bleeding of the cooling system cannot be overstated. Any air trapped in the system can lead to serious issues, mimicking a faulty thermostat or causing actual overheating. Take your time with this step.

Cooling System Bleeding Techniques

  • Elevate the Front End: If possible, park your Civic with the front end slightly elevated (e.g., on ramps). This helps trapped air migrate to the radiator filler neck.
  • Squeeze Hoses: While the engine is running and warming up, repeatedly squeeze the upper and lower radiator hoses. This helps to push air bubbles out.
  • “Burp” the System: With the radiator cap off and the engine running, watch for bubbles. As the thermostat opens, you’ll often see a large “burp” of air. Continue to top off the coolant.

Testing and Ongoing Care

  • Monitor Temperature Gauge: For the first few drives, pay close attention to your temperature gauge. It should remain stable in the middle range.
  • Check for Leaks: After driving and allowing the engine to cool, inspect the thermostat housing and all hose connections for any signs of coolant leaks.
  • Coolant Level Checks: Regularly check your coolant level in the overflow reservoir and, occasionally, in the radiator itself (when cold).
  • Periodic Maintenance: Consider flushing your coolant system every 30,000-50,000 miles, or as recommended by Honda, as part of your 2004 Honda Civic thermostat replacement care guide. Fresh coolant maintains system integrity.

Common Problems and Troubleshooting Tips

Even with the best intentions, sometimes things don’t go exactly as planned. Knowing the common problems with 2004 Honda Civic thermostat replacement can help you diagnose and fix issues quickly.

The most frequent issue after a thermostat replacement is persistent overheating or an unstable temperature gauge. This nearly always points to air trapped in the system or, less commonly, a faulty new part.

Troubleshooting Post-Replacement Issues

  • Persistent Overheating/Erratic Gauge:
    • Air in System: This is the #1 culprit. Re-do the bleeding procedure thoroughly. Ensure the front of the car is elevated if possible.
    • Faulty New Thermostat: While rare, new parts can be defective. If bleeding doesn’t work, you might have received a bad thermostat.
    • Incorrect Thermostat: Did you install the correct temperature rating? An incorrect one can cause issues.
  • Coolant Leaks:
    • Improper Gasket Seal: The mating surfaces might not have been perfectly clean, or the gasket wasn’t seated correctly. Disassemble, clean, and reassemble with a new gasket.
    • Loose Bolts: Ensure the thermostat housing bolts are tightened to specification (but not overtightened!).
    • Damaged Housing: In rare cases, the plastic housing might be cracked or warped. Inspect it carefully before reassembly.
    • Loose Hose Clamp: Double-check the lower radiator hose clamp.
  • No Heat from Heater:
    • Air in Heater Core: Another symptom of trapped air. Continue bleeding the system.
    • Low Coolant Level: Ensure the system is full.

If you’ve tried all these troubleshooting steps and are still experiencing problems, it might be time to consult a professional mechanic. Don’t risk further engine damage.

Sustainable Practices for Your Thermostat Replacement

At FatBoysOffroad, we believe in responsible car ownership, and that extends to our environmental impact. Incorporating sustainable 2004 Honda Civic thermostat replacement and eco-friendly 2004 Honda Civic thermostat replacement practices is easy and important.

Automotive fluids, especially coolant, are toxic and should never be disposed of in household drains or on the ground. Proper disposal protects our environment and wildlife.

Eco-Friendly Tips

  • Recycle Old Coolant: Most auto parts stores, service stations, and municipal waste facilities accept used coolant for recycling. Store it in a clearly labeled, sealed container.
  • Dispose of Parts Responsibly: Metal thermostat housings can often be recycled with scrap metal. Check with your local recycling center.
  • Choose Quality Parts: Opting for high-quality, reputable brands for your replacement thermostat means it will likely last longer, reducing the frequency of replacements and the associated waste.
  • Clean Up Spills: Use absorbent materials like kitty litter or shop towels to clean up any coolant spills immediately. Dispose of contaminated materials properly.

Frequently Asked Questions About 2004 Honda Civic Thermostat Replacement

We’ve covered a lot, but you might still have some lingering questions. Here are answers to some common queries about this DIY job.

How long does a 2004 Honda Civic thermostat replacement typically take?

For an experienced DIYer, this job can usually be completed in 1 to 2 hours. If you’re new to it, budget 2-4 hours, including draining and refilling the coolant and proper bleeding of the system.

Do I need to replace the thermostat housing with the thermostat?

Not always. If your housing is plastic and shows signs of cracking, warping, or damage, or if it has been overtightened in the past, replacing it along with the thermostat and gasket is a good idea. If it’s metal and in good shape, just the thermostat and gasket are usually sufficient.

What kind of coolant should I use for my 2004 Honda Civic?

Always refer to your owner’s manual. Honda Civics typically use a specific type of coolant, often a blue or green long-life (OAT or HOAT) coolant. Using the wrong type can cause corrosion and damage to your cooling system components.

Is it safe to drive with a bad thermostat?

It is generally not recommended. A thermostat stuck closed can quickly lead to severe engine overheating and permanent damage. A thermostat stuck open will cause your engine to run inefficiently, wear faster, and significantly reduce heater performance. Address the issue as soon as possible.

What if I still have air in my cooling system after bleeding?

If you’ve bled the system multiple times and still suspect air, try parking the car on an incline with the front elevated. Run the engine with the radiator cap off until it reaches operating temperature, and continue to squeeze hoses. Some stubborn air pockets can take several drive cycles to work their way out. Ensure your heater is on full blast to open the heater core valve.
